A small rural Nova Scotia community, and the province, is coming to grips with a 12-hour shooting spree that killed 22 people, (at 16 crime scenes) in the deadliest mass shooting in Canadian history this past weekend.

Last night a virtual vigil was held to share love and light during this tragic time. It was very moving to see that the light of the world was with us during this unbelievable and devastating time.
